Ingredients
For the Seafood
- 1 salmon fillet (about 12 oz / 340 g), cut into bite-sized chunks
- 12–15 large sh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
For the Creamy Garlic Sauce
- 1 tablespoon butter
- 5 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 cup heavy cream
- ½ c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
- ½ cup chicken broth or seafood stock
- 1 teaspoon lemon juice
- ½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
- Salt and black pepper, to taste
For the Rice
- 2 cups cooked white rice
- 1 tablespoon butter
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
For Garnish
- Extra Parmesan cheese
- Fresh parsley
- Lemon wedges

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Season the Seafood
Pat the salmon and shrimp dry with paper towels.
Season both with paprika, Italian seasoning,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per.
2. Cook the Salmon
Heat the olive oil and 2 tablespoons of butter in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
Cook the salmon pieces for about 2–3 minutes per side until lightly golden and just cooked through.
Transfer to a plate.
3. Cook the Shrimp
Using the same skillet, cook the shrimp for 1–2 minutes per side until pink and opaque.
Transfer them to the plate with the salmon.
4. Prepare the Garlic Parmesan Sauce
Reduce the heat to medium.
Add the remaining tablespoon of butter and sauté the minced garlic for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
Pour in the chicken broth and simmer for 2 minutes.
Add the heavy cream and stir until combined.
Gradually whisk in the Parmesan cheese until the sauce becomes smooth and creamy.
Add the lemon juice and crushed red pepper flakes if using.
Season with salt and black pepper to taste.
5. Return the Seafood
Gently return the salmon and shrimp to the skillet.
Spoon the sauce over the seafood and simmer for 2–3 minutes.

6. Prepare the Rice
Warm the cooked rice with the butter and chopped parsley until heated through.
7. Serve
Divide the rice among serving plates.
Top with the creamy garlic shrimp and salmon.
Spoon extra sauce over the rice and garnish with Parmesan cheese, fresh parsley, and lemon wedges.

Pro Tips & Variations
For perfectly cooked seafood, avoid overcooking both the salmon and shrimp. Salmon should flake easily with a fork while remaining moist, and shrimp should be removed from the heat as soon as they turn pink and opaque. Freshly grated Parmesan cheese creates a smoother sauce than pre-shredded varieties and melts more evenly into the cream.
If you’re looking for healthy substitutions, use half-and-half instead of heavy cream or substitute brown rice, quinoa, or cauliflower rice for traditional white rice. Add fresh spinach, broccoli, asparagus, mushrooms, or peas to make the meal even more nutritious. A splash of white wine can also be added to the sauce before the cream for extra depth of flavor.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es. The sauce and rice can be prepared ahead of time. Cook the seafood just before serving for the best texture and flavor.
What can I substitute for salmon?
Cod, halibut, tilapia, mahi-mahi, or even boneless chicken breast work well in this recipe.
How do I store leftovers?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ently over low heat with a splash of cream or broth to keep the sauce smooth.
Is this recipe good for meal prep?
Yes. While seafood is best enjoyed fresh, this dish reheats well and makes an excellent lunch or dinner for the following day.
